Masata Public Welfare Initiative Enters Tibet — Supporting Children’s Healthy Growth
From May 29 to 30, 2025, ahead of International Children’s Day, Singapore’s well-known baby and child skincare brand Masata partnered with the Lodi Public Welfare Alliance to travel across mountains and rivers into the Tibet Autonomous Region. The team visited Dongga Town Central Primary School and Zhongda Town Central Primary School in Lang County, Nyingchi City, carrying out a two-day public welfare initiative themed “Childlike Dreams · Growing Minds”.
The goal was to bring festive blessings, care, and companionship to children living in high-altitude regions.

Bringing Warmth to the Plateau Through Action
In the refreshing May climate of southeastern Tibet, the Masata public welfare team and alliance volunteers visited two rural primary schools over the course of two days.
They provided students with practical items such as learning supplies, sports equipment, and skincare products, while also organizing a series of thoughtfully designed interactive programs to create a joyful and memorable holiday experience for both teachers and students.
At Dongga Town Central Primary School, Masata participated as a representative philanthropic enterprise in the school’s “National Unity as One Family” cultural performance. Students dressed in traditional ethnic attire and showcased local dance and music, expressing the vibrant spirit of Tibet’s younger generation. Masata volunteers also joined the campus carnival activities, building genuine connections with the children through relaxed and heartwarming interactions.
Meanwhile, at Zhongda Town Central Primary School, the Masata team supported the school’s “Red Scarves Love the Motherland” themed activities and “Remember the Party’s Teachings, Become a Strong Nation’s Youth” educational program. Through a flag-raising ceremony, themed class meetings, and a drawing competition, the activities encouraged students to develop aspirations that align personal growth with national development. The atmosphere was lively, and the children expressed their dreams and determination through their drawings and heartfelt words.
